Full Job Description
Job title: Enterprise Data Architect

Location: Austin, TX

Duration: Long Term

Job Description:

The Medicaid Data Architect position is an Information Technology (IT) position and will be a part Performance Management and Analytics System (PMAS) team under the Office of Chief Data Architect in Health and Human Services System's IT domain. This position is required to create data architecture(s) related to Texas Medicaid data in compliance with Texas Data Management Framework (TDMF) and HHS Data Governance (DG) policies.

The Enterprise Architect position:

Collaborates with the Office of the Chief Data Architect on initiatives related to performance analytics and data governance.

Architects cloud data hub integrations with Medicaid data and other data domain platforms.

Develops best practices and methodologies to mature TDMF best practices and capability maturities. Develops enterprise data policy and standards that support the development of an enterprise data governance framework.

Serves as Data Architecture and Data Management expert for the HHS system, Medicaid.

Develops a detailed knowledge of the underlying HHS data assets and data products and provides subject matter expert on content, current and potential future uses of data.

Assists in development and implementation of data quality processes and metrics.

Responsible for consulting with the business owners of data assets, providers of enterprise analytics, and Information Technology leadership to develop enterprise Medicaid analytics strategy for future funding, design, and implementation

Provides expertise in data harmonization, master data development and governance, data quality, and metadata management.

Provides guidelines on creating data models and various standards relating to governed data.

Reviews changes to technical and business metadata, realizing their impacts on enterprise applications, and ensures the impacts are communicated to appropriate parties.

Establishes measures to chart progress related to the completeness and quality of metadata for enterprise information to support reduction of data redundancy and fragmentation and elimination of unnecessary movement of data; and to improve data quality.

Assists in selecting data management tools and developing the standards, usage guidelines, and procedures for using those tools.

Assists in identifying appropriate data sourcing and extraction processes, and in identifying and nominating sources as systems of record for data usage in various applications.

Assists in performing root cause analyses related to information issues and non-conformance to published data standards based on review of technical metadata of various source systems.

Builds business cases to support collaborative HHS MDM efforts and adoption.

Works with CTO office, CDA architecture team, and MCS program stakeholders to come up with Medicaid data and analytics strategy considering long term goals/objectives.

Strategic Liaison and Translation

Work with program areas and project sponsor to plan and execute multiple analytics projects asynchronously.

Explain project findings and data limitations in simple, non-technical language to agency leadership and program staff.

AI Prompting and Data Synthesis

Develop and refine effective AI prompts and query strategies to retrieve and synthesize Medicaid data for complex data domains.

Develop a library of standardized prompts and query templates for common reporting needs.

Provide subject matter expertise on validating output from AI, particularly with respect to identifying and mitigating hallucinations.

Ensure all data outputs adhere to agency reporting standards, data governance, and compliance regulations.

Promote a data-driven culture by enabling and empowering all staff to effectively utilize data and AI.

Stay up to date on new AI and data analytics tools and techniques to continuously improve program competencies.

Collaboration and Problem-Solving

Work closely with data engineering, IT, and Program teams to troubleshoot data-related issues and address inconsistencies and mitigation strategies.

Provide expert guidance to program staff on interpreting data trends and answering complex data questions.
